在Ubuntu系统中,网关的配置通常保存在/etc/network/interfaces文件中,或者通过nmcli(NetworkManager Command Line Interface)进行管理。当不再需要某个网关时,可以通过以下方法进行删除:
方法一:编辑/etc/network/interfaces文件
打开终端。
使用文本编辑器打开/etc/network/interfaces文件,例如使用nano编辑器:
sudo nano /etc/network/interfaces
在文件中找到对应网关的配置行。网关的配置通常以gateway关键字开始,例如:
gateway 192.168.1.1
删除或注释掉该行(将行首的#符号删除,或者直接删除整行)。
保存并关闭文件。在nano编辑器中,按Ctrl + X,然后按Y确认保存,最后按Enter键。
重启网络服务以应用更改:
sudo service networking restart
或者使用systemctl命令:
```bash
sudo systemctl restart networking
```
方法二:使用nmcli命令行工具
打开终端。
使用nmcli命令查看当前的网络连接:
nmcli con show
找到需要删除网关的网络连接名称。
使用以下命令删除网关:
nmcli con mod <连接名称> +gateway <网关IP>
其中<连接名称>是你要修改的连接的名称,<网关IP>是你想要删除的网关的IP地址。
如果你想完全删除网关配置,可以使用以下命令:
nmcli con mod <连接名称> --gateway <网关IP>
重启网络服务或重启计算机以应用更改。
注意事项
在删除网关之前,请确保你有其他可用的网关或网络连接,以免网络中断。
如果你在删除网关后遇到网络问题,请检查其他网络设置,如DNS服务器或IP地址配置。
通过以上方法,你可以在Ubuntu系统中轻松地删除不再使用的网关。